Блог Андрія Огороднікова Хто з мечем до нас прийде, від меча й загине.

Что нам делать с пьяным матросом… то есть Firefox 57+?

04.11.2017, 01:21

nightly firefox 58

А я пытаюсь пользоваться сверхновым браузером Файрфокс-Квантум (Firefox 57+). Файрфоксом, который отрубил свое наследие в виде сотен и сотен прекрасных расширений/дополнений. И принялся базироваться на той же технологии, что и почти нерасширяемый ГуглХром. Этот оффтоп важен, потому как браузер — рабочий инструмент для меня и как блоггера, и как сайтостроителя.

Пока впечатления такие:

1) Дубовый интерфейс избыточных размеров в панелях, вкладках и кнопках, занимает много места. Ну и просто плосок и уныл. Это, в отличие от версий до 56-й, НЕ НАСТРАИВАЕТСЯ — чем меня всегда бесил хром (и его клоны), и чем радовал прежний ффокс, позволявший создавать рабочую среду под себя с высокой точностью.

2) Минимум расширений доступны, благо — хотя бы резалка рекламы uBlock Origin оперативно обновилась. Более 80% расширений — увы. И это засада, ибо многие из них были инструментарием, а не просто рюшками-пердушками.

3) Что радует — скорость работы, ну.. может быть, постольку поскольку, не навешано расширений. Дык эдак и так — без аддонов любой фокс летает… Как-то пока неубедительно. Сэкономить полсекунды или даже меньше, но потерять функционал, который экономит часы и нервы… Фиг его знает, стоит ли оно того? Все равно — ведь Хром им не догнать по популярности, но при этом потерять свое лицо…

Похоже на то, что займусь написанием какой-то заметки на эту тему на основном бло. Ведь придется привыкать и как-то пользоваться, назад дороги нет. Не выход — сидеть на старых версиях и даже родственных проектах, таких как Seamonkey, горячо мной любимый, потому что пилить и залатывать старый движок никто не будет в Мозилле, а поддерживать и актуализировать оный у альтернативных команд просто не хватит сил и средств. Симанки и так на ладан дышит. Palemoon сидит на фактическом копролите (окаменелом фекалии, если кто не знает палеонтологическую терминологию))… А Web не останавливается в развитии и хорошего, и плохого. И по этому океану на этой лодке нужно плыть, желательно без дыр и протечек.

Цитата с велобло, знаменующая множественность последующих исследований. На тему жизни и творчества с нещадно мутировавшим огненным лисом.

З-ка будет дополняться тут.

День Д, когда выйдет стабильная ветка с движком Quantum (FF57), по плану будет в ноябре. Но уже сейчас все это грандиозное великолепие доступно в бетах и альфах.

—=•=·•·=•=—

Вот жеж фук.. 1,2 гб памяти отожралось на 6 вкладках… После определенного времени работы, отмеченного прироста в скорости уже не наблюдается, а лаги и зависания заметнее, чем в предыдущих версиях. Ексельшмок.

Предварительный тезис: если в ближайшее время не решится кардинально вопрос с обновлением/альтернативизацией расширений, а браузер будет и в стабильных версиях вытворять такое (к примеру, я пишу вот этот текст, а файрфокс то и дело «не отвечает»!!!), я буду очень серьезно рассматривать вопрос о пересаживании на какой-то из клонов Хрома. До сих пор на фоксе меня держали расширения, даже учитывая более тормознутую работу… Разработчики сделали очень рисковую ставку и пошли ва-банк, возможно, это будет означать, что файрфокс, лишенный основного, главнейшего своего преимущества — расширений, канет в небытие, утратив и без того малую долю на рынке. Хомячки и хаузвайфы и так все на хроме, а теперь с фокса уйдут и продвинутые пользователи. И останутся только закоренелые фанаты лиса или случайные прохожие.

02.10.2017: Обновил картинку. Интересный момент, если уменьшить размер окна браузера, то между первой вкладкой и краем появляется пустое мѣсто… А различные неявнонужные элементы в адресной строке, когда индицируется «безопасное» соединение, для адреса собственно места почти не оставляют.. иногда его и не видно, в особо пиковых случаях.

no

Сколько было сломано клавиатур, когда разрабы защищали свой предыдущий «революционный» интерфейс «австралис» с почти по синусоиде скругленными вкладками! И что же? Где же этот шедевр эргономики и эстетики? И звездочка-закладка — которую они в австралисе вытеснили прочь из адреса, а теперь вернули, будто и не было ничего. Эта непоследовательность говорит о том, что всем пофиг. Как склепали, как нацепили оформление на двигло, так и будет.

Фончик шершавый просто фончик — по стандарту есть два варианта сильно светлого и один вариант среднетемного оформления. Чтобы как-то вытерпеть, приходится подкладывать — срабатывают старые «персонас» или как они там называются.

Главный вопрос, он же и ответ в том, что в таких крупных проектах программеры из средне-южной Азии кодят на мощных корпоративных компах с неограниченными запасами оперативки, ресурсов многоядерных процессоров и скорости твердотельных дисков. И никто из них даже не думает отлаживать код на чем-то еще. Поэтому и получается прожорливый монстр, которому мало и неуютно в спартанской среде все еще очень хорошего среднепользовательского оборудования.

Но откровенно самоубийственные решения «директората» разработчиков это не объясняет.

—=•=·•·=•=—

Что по дополнениям (год назад я пытался накрапывать на эту тему, и та статья полностью потеряла актуальность!!!).

1) uBlock Origin — резалка рекламы, которая обновилась под 57+ раньше АдблокаПлюса. Да и вообще, в последнее время уБлок мне больше нравится.

2) ScreenGrab! — снятие скриншотов целиковой страницы или ее участков — автор подогнал свой вариант из Хрома — так как теперь это один базис «WebExentions», на старом фоксе управлялось оно по другому, но работает. Хотя теперь есть штатная скриншотилка в фф, как и много чего другого засунутого по умолчанию, съедающего ресурс и не нужного всем. [!! Удивительно, что теперь не каждую страницу можно соскринить целиком! Как стандартным, так и ScreenGrab! — не ясно по какому качану, и это.. подозрительно-печально.]

3) Вместо функционала чудеснейшего расширения с говорящим названием «Менеджер Сессий», список и отмену закрытых вкладок показывает «Undo Close Tab». Это даже не паллиатив, а просто кусочек пластыря…

4) Страницы целиком в единый файл сохраняет «Save Page WE» — без особых настроек, в отличие от любимого мной UnMHT — сохранение происходит в формат html, вместе с иллюстрациями. Я еще не смотрел, скорее всего картинки перекодируются в BASE64 или типа того и вставляются напрямую в код. На выходе получается хтмлшка вместо мхтшки, но браузеры прекрасно кушают это творение, потому что никаких стандартов не нарушено. Такую страничку можно склепывать и самостоятельно, полноценный сайт реально сделать из одного файла, так что терпимо. (Да, импортируются стили, скрипты, а картинки в base64, вполне хорошее решение, если говорить откровенно).

5) Для видео врубился Video Downloader Professional — я пока не тестил, но сам факт наличия под 57+.

6) Для приведения поисковых адресов в божеский вид пришлось использовать расширение Neat Url.

На данный момент это ВСЁ..

НО около десятка основных рабочих расширений пока не обновлены или невозможны из-за другой «природы» нового движка.

Что до интерфейса, похоже придется писать стили руками, если это возможно. В старых фоксах такая «фича» была, можно было много чего подправлять, просто мне хватало возможностей того же Classic Theme Restorer. Но это может касаться лишь размеров панелей или расстояний между значками. Вернуть былую гибкость интерфейсу невозможно. Пользовательские панели с разнообразнейшими кнопками (Toolbar Buttons, Custom Buttons итд) канули в лету.

—=•=·•·=•=—

Конечно, аутоэкзекуцию можно отложить на неопределенный (или определенный) срок. Аж до февраля 18 года будет существовать и Файрфокс 52 ESR — «с длительным сроком поддержки». Это официально, и все прежние расширения на нем прекрасно работают. Можно сидеть на последней версии релизного фокса за номером 56. Ну по моему мнению, годик протянуть можно.

Я, конечно, буду продолжать настраивать изо всех сил новый файрфокс под себя, если это будет иметь хоть какой-то реальный смысл. Но основным мои браузером останется Seamonkey (на данный момент есть альфа 2.54). Как долго они продержатся — неведомо. Там больше голого энтузиазма, чем корпоративного труда. И все это туманно.

А из хромоклонов наибольший перспективный интерес представляет Vivaldi — если они выберутся из багов и недоработок. Пока без раздражения тем браузером пользоваться нереально, я раз пять пытался, в том числе и намедни. Если кто не знает, они пытаются скопировать «старую оперу» на основе Хромиума. Т.е отличный многофункциональный швейцарский нож выточить из тесака.